A. K. Choudhary is a scholar working on Civil and Structural Engineering, Safety, Risk, Reliability and Quality and Industrial and Manufacturing Engineering. According to data from OpenAlex, A. K. Choudhary has authored 26 papers receiving a total of 337 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Civil and Structural Engineering, 13 papers in Safety, Risk, Reliability and Quality and 4 papers in Industrial and Manufacturing Engineering. Recurrent topics in A. K. Choudhary's work include Geotechnical Engineering and Soil Stabilization (21 papers), Geotechnical Engineering and Underground Structures (14 papers) and Geotechnical Engineering and Analysis (13 papers). A. K. Choudhary is often cited by papers focused on Geotechnical Engineering and Soil Stabilization (21 papers), Geotechnical Engineering and Underground Structures (14 papers) and Geotechnical Engineering and Analysis (13 papers). A. K. Choudhary collaborates with scholars based in India, Australia and Ethiopia. A. K. Choudhary's co-authors include J. N. Jha, K. S. Gill, Sanjay Kumar Shukla, G. L. Sivakumar Babu, Sufyan Ghani, Sunita Kumari, Bhardwaj Pandit, S. Dash, Panagiotis G. Asteris and Ishwor Thapa and has published in prestigious journals such as Scientific Reports, Australasian Journal of Paramedicine and Geotextiles and Geomembranes.
